What a finale! So many questions... does Marla say 'I do?', do Noah and Rosa become Deaconsfield's hottest couple?, do Cam and Frankie follow in Marla and Elliott's footsteps and get married…? and OLIVE????????!!!!!!!?????!!!!! We want to know what she's got to tell us…!! Like, NOW!

It has been a rollarcoaster series 3 - we've said goodbye and then hello again, seen friendships blossoming and falling apart, met a new McKinnon and seen how difficult it can be to start a new life, seen a fair amount of snogging, copped a full-frontal of Elliott's chest and watched Alex go on a delicate personal journey. It's been immense - and the final installment is now available on iplayer for you to watch again and again.
